The Ultimate Guide To Rooftents: Everything You Need To Know

When it comes to camping and outdoor adventures, rooftop tents have become increasingly popular in recent years. These innovative tent systems are mounted onto the roof of a vehicle, providing a comfortable and convenient sleeping space that is elevated off the ground. In this comprehensive guide, we will explore everything you need to know about rooftop tents, their benefits, and how to choose the right one for your next outdoor excursion.

rooftents, also known as rooftop tents or RTTs, offer a unique camping experience that combines the convenience of car camping with the comfort of a traditional tent. These tents are designed to be mounted on the roof of a vehicle using a rooftop tent rack or a roof rack system. This elevated sleeping platform not only provides better views and added security, but it also keeps campers safe from potential ground hazards like flooding, insects, and wild animals.

One of the biggest advantages of a rooftop tent is its quick and easy setup. Most rooftop tents can be fully assembled in a matter of minutes, making them ideal for campers who want to spend less time setting up camp and more time enjoying the great outdoors. In addition, rooftop tents typically come with a built-in mattress, providing a comfortable sleeping arrangement that is far superior to sleeping on the ground in a traditional tent.

Another benefit of rooftop tents is their versatility. Unlike traditional ground tents that require a flat and level surface for setup, rooftop tents can be pitched on uneven or sloping terrain, giving campers more flexibility when choosing a campsite. This makes rooftop tents ideal for off-road enthusiasts and travelers who like to explore remote and rugged landscapes.

When it comes to choosing a rooftop tent, there are several factors to consider. The first thing to think about is the size of the tent. rooftents come in a variety of sizes, from compact two-person tents to spacious family-sized tents that can accommodate four or more campers. Make sure to choose a tent that fits the size of your vehicle and meets your camping needs.

Another important consideration is the type of rooftop tent. There are two main types of rooftop tents: hardshell tents and softshell tents. Hardshell tents have a solid, clamshell-style roof that provides added protection from the elements and offers a more streamlined design when closed. Softshell tents, on the other hand, are made of fabric and typically have a more traditional tent shape. Both types of rooftop tents have their own set of advantages and disadvantages, so it’s important to choose the one that best suits your needs.

In addition to the size and type of tent, there are other features to consider when selecting a rooftop tent. Look for tents that have high-quality materials, such as ripstop canvas or polyester, that are durable and weather-resistant. It’s also important to consider the weight of the tent and its compatibility with your vehicle’s roof rack system. Some rooftop tents are designed to be lightweight and aerodynamic, while others are more heavy-duty and robust.
